One driver is getting ticketed for following too close after a chain reaction crash that involved five vehicles.
The crash happened at about 2:15 p.m. Christmas Eve in Cañon City.
Police say the driver of a blue Chevy pickup hit a red Jeep at a traffic light on Highway 50 and Reynolds. The impact of the crash pushed the Jeep into another car.
Traffic was diverted for about an hour while crews cleaned up the mess.
Four people were taken to the hospital. Police did not know the extent of their injuries. No drugs or alcohol are suspected of being involved in the crash.
The driver of the pickup was cited with following too close.
